Hop Brook is a physical feature (stream) in Hampshire County. The primary coordinates for Hop Brook places it within the MA 01002 ZIP Code delivery area.

Description: | Heads at 422013N0722545W, flows S thorugh Holland Glen then NW to the Fort River 0.9 mi ENE of Mill Valley; Towns of Amherst and Belchertown. |
